> 3 dayWhen I first opened it up I was impressed. It LOOKED quite sturdy. After using once I was happy with it. The second time didn’t go so well. A 10-15 mile wind got under it, inverted it and destroyed it. It happened on a busy street too so I was the laughing stock. The “sturdy” skeleton turned out to be made of black brittle plastic, I had thought they were metal. The plastic pieces snapped. The so called vents are so tight they don’t let any air through to relieve the pressure and so the umbrella inverts and brakes the plastic parts before the vents release pressure. Another product designed to LOOK sturdy but will soon end up in a landfill. If you live in an area with no wind, it might last longer than it did for me. Back to my 5.00 umbella that I bought in 1995 that is on its last leg but is a lot sturdier than this.
